In the office i work in we had a wild cat strike last year after seeing a colleague reduced to tears after two bulling dums had interviewed him regarding attendance. They had also tried to bully all members of staff in some way.
When we went back we suffered all this crap about sticking your hand up for the toilet (some of us just went to the toilet as usual). We had managers patrolling aisle's one manager patrolling 3 of us in the part of the office i then worked at. We had one manager logging in what time you got back, he tried to get about 5 of us to go back out delivering when we got back 10 minutes before end time, we didn't. They then flooded the place with managers from all over the country (all staying in the local hotel, which aint cheap) + foreign casuals & still couldn't clear the mail without our co-operation. They walked a york full of drinks & sweets in & told us these are not for you, but managers & casuals. Managers will lie & twist things to get you to do more, diaries it all with witnesses.
The good news is before we went back we had a manager moved & now the other one has left.
